Description
Job PurposeTo supervise and coordinate daily joinery, carpentry, modular and fit-out activities, ensuring that work is completed according to approved drawings, required quality standards, production schedules and safety requirements. The Foreman will lead the workshop/site team, allocate work, monitor progress and ensure timely completion of assigned tasks.Key Responsibilities Supervise and coordinate daily activities of carpenters, joiners and fit-out workers. Allocate tasks to team members based on production priorities, skills and workload. Monitor daily work progress and ensure activities are completed within the planned schedule. Read and interpret drawings, specifications and work instructions related to joinery, carpentry and fit-out works. Supervise the fabrication and installation of wooden, modular and interior fit-out components. Ensure proper measurement, cutting, assembly, finishing and installation of joinery works. Check the quality and accuracy of completed work and ensure compliance with approved standards. Coordinate with Production, Design, Engineering and other departments to resolve work-related issues. Ensure that required materials, tools and equipment are available before commencing work. Monitor material usage and minimize wastage. Identify defects, workmanship issues or deviations and arrange necessary corrections. Guide and train team members on proper working methods and workmanship standards. Ensure that tools, machinery and the work area are maintained in a safe and organized condition. Ensure employees follow company safety procedures and use the required PPE. Maintain discipline and productivity within the assigned team. Report daily progress, manpower requirements, material requirements and production issues to the reporting manager. Support urgent and time-sensitive production requirements and ensure deadlines are achieved. Coordinate with other trades during fit-out activities to avoid delays or clashes.
